How to do the Standing Hamstring and Calf Stretch
- 1
Being by looping a belt, band, or rope around one foot. While standing, place that foot forward.
- 2
Bend your back leg, while keeping the front one straight. Now raise the toes of your front foot off of the ground and lean forward.
- 3
Using the belt, pull on the top of the foot to increase the stretch in the calf. Hold for 10-20 seconds and repeat with the other foot.
